Dinas (Rhondda) train station, while not equipped with a ticket office or ticket machines, does ensure accessibility for all users. True to its Category A accessibility status, the station offers step-free access to both platforms via a footbridge with lifts. Despite the absence of wa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ities, there's a touch of convenience with seating areas available for weary travelers. Moreover, the presence of an induction loop caters to those with hearing impairments, ensuring the station is user-friendly for everyone.
Contrary to its limited in-station facilities, Dinas (Rhondda) provides you with sufficient links for onward travel. A rail replacement bus service is available, with stops conveniently located on Brithweunydd Road. Whether you're heading towards Treherbert or Pontypridd, there are accessible options via local transport links, making it easy to plan further travel from Dinas (Rhondda) without any hitches.

Nestled in the quaint sea-side town of Chalkwell, Essex, Chalkwell Train Station serves as a convenient jumping-off point for both commuters and leisure travelers alike. Situated on the London, Tilbury & Southend line, it offers a scenic journey with views over the Thames Estuary, making your travels truly enjoyable. Chalkwell station strives to cater to all your needs. The ticket office operates early from Monday to Sunday, offering friendly assistance from 5:15 AM to 7:45 PM on weekdays and slightly reduced hours during weekends. Don't worry if you are an early bird or a night owl, as you can collect online-purchased tickets from the ticket machines anytime. The station is equipped with induction loops for the hearing impaired and has customer help points available for assistance. Unfortunately, there is no luggage storage, and the lack of step-free access could be a hindrance for travelers with mobility issues. Waiting rooms on Platforms 1 and 2 offer a comfortable reprieve with seating areas available throughout the station.
For those needing alternative travel options, Chalkwell provides various transport links. Rail replacement services and taxis can easily be accessed from the station entrance. The convenience of requesting taxis directly outside the station allows for seamless onward journeys, whether you're heading to London Fenchurch Street, West Ham, or exploring local areas like Southend Central and Leigh-On-Sea.
